The car I have for sale is a 1999 Camaro with 109,xxx miles on it. The car has a strong running LS1 and has a 4L60E transmission that shifts perfectly. There are no mechanical flaws with the car, but there are some cosmetic details that need some attention. The car needs a driver's side front fender, bumper, and headlight. A person could fix the hood if it came down to it, but it would probably be eaiser to just buy a new one. It also has some damage on the rear quarter panels...one from a recent crash and one from a previous fix that seems to be cracking out. The car was originally red, but it has been repainted black, but it was done poorly and needs a repaint.
The front seats are worn out, but the rest of the interior is decent aside from being a little dirty. The wheels are 16-inch stockers and the tires are "good enough" but will need replaced soon. I figure that anyone that buys it will replace the wheels anyway. It has discs on all four corners and they are new, but have a squeak. They work just fine, but make some noise. The car isn't the best out there, but for someone that wants a cheap project, this is the one. The car runs and drives great and for $3,800 it's a steal compared to any other LS1 car.
